You'd think the blue power bus connector would tip some modular expert
off.
Notice the two 1-12 way switches with numbers in the middle. They could
set up some rythm/synch/timing. On the image it's set to 6/4, maybe it's
the signature?
At the top, there are two buttons labelled S/S and S. They could be
Start/Stop and Step.
Maybe it's an arpeggiator?
